Prepare the crust: In a medium mixing bowl, combine the crushed graham crackers, melted butter, and 2 tablespoons granulated sugar. Mix well until the texture resembles wet sand.
Press the crust mixture firmly and evenly into the bottom of a parchment-lined 9x9-inch baking dish. Place in the refrigerator to chill while preparing the cheesecake filling.
Prepare the cheesecake filling: In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y.
In a separate chilled bowl, whip the heavy whipping cream until stiff peaks form.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until fully combined.
Spread the cheesecake filling evenly over the chilled crust. Smooth the top with a spatula and return to the refrigerator to set for at least 4 hours or overnight.
Prepare the strawberry topping: In a small saucepan over medium heat, combine the diced strawberries, cornstarch, 1/4 cup granulated sugar, and water. Stir frequently until the mixture thickens and resembles a glaze. Remove from heat and let cool to room temperature.
Once the cheesecake has set, spread the cooled strawberry topping evenly over the cheesecake layer. Refrigerate for an additional 1 hour to allow the topping to set.
Slice into bars and serve chilled.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
